We know many residents will have seen national news coverage about new food waste collections being introduced across the country that will help increase the amount of we recycle and reduce waste.

We were on track to launch our food waste service in March, with caddies ready and staff trained – we were just awaiting the delivery of our new specialist food waste vehicles. Although we placed our vehicle order nearly a year ago, our supplier experienced exceptionally high demand due to councils nationwide introducing food waste collections at the same time. This impacted delivery times and has meant we have had to delay the launch of our new service.

Once our vehicle delivery is confirmed, we’ll begin rolling out caddies and information to households ahead of the service starting. We’re hoping to launch in summer 2026.

We’ll continue to keep residents updated and share more details as soon as we can, as we know lots of residents are looking forward to getting started. Keep up to date.
